Essential Electrician Equipment for Lighting Contractors

Hand Tools: The Foundation of Every Toolbox

Every lighting contractor’s toolkit begins with a set of high-quality hand tools. These include insulated screwdrivers, wire strippers, pliers, and voltage testers. Insulation is critical to protect against electrical shocks, especially when working with live circuits.

Wire strippers and cutters designed specifically for electrical wiring ensure clean and accurate cuts, which are vital for secure connections and long-term reliability. Precision screwdrivers and pliers help in handling small components often found in lighting fixtures and control panels. Additionally, a good set of crimping tools is essential for creating strong connections with connectors and terminals, ensuring that all electrical connections remain intact over time. The right hand tools not only improve efficiency but also contribute to the overall quality of the installation, as they allow for meticulous work in tight spaces.

Power Tools and Drills

Power drills and drivers are indispensable for installing mounting brackets, conduit, and fixtures. Cordless models with lithium-ion batteries offer convenience and mobility, allowing contractors to work efficiently in various environments without being tethered to power outlets.

Using the right drill bits, such as those designed for metal or masonry, ensures clean holes and prevents damage to structural elements. This attention to detail not only improves the quality of installation but also reduces rework and client dissatisfaction. Furthermore, impact drivers can significantly speed up the process of driving screws into tough materials, making them a valuable addition to any lighting contractor’s arsenal. The versatility of these power tools allows for quick adjustments and modifications on-site, catering to the unique demands of each lighting project.

Testing and Diagnostic Equipment

Modern lighting systems often incorporate complex wiring and electronic components. Multimeters, circuit testers, and insulation resistance testers are essential for verifying electrical parameters and ensuring system integrity.

Advanced diagnostic tools like thermal imaging cameras can detect overheating connections or faulty components before they cause failures. This proactive approach to troubleshooting enhances safety and minimizes downtime, which is critical in commercial and industrial lighting projects. Additionally, data loggers can be utilized to monitor electrical consumption and performance over time, providing valuable insights that can lead to energy savings and improved system efficiency. By equipping themselves with these advanced tools, contractors can offer clients a higher level of service and assurance regarding the reliability of their lighting systems.

Safety Gear: Protecting the Contractor

Safety is paramount in electrical work. Personal protective equipment (PPE) such as insulated gloves, safety glasses, hard hats, and flame-resistant clothing are mandatory to comply with occupational safety standards.

Proper PPE not only safeguards contractors from electrical hazards but also boosts confidence and productivity. Investing in high-quality safety gear reflects a commitment to professional responsibility and reduces the risk of workplace injuries. Moreover, incorporating additional safety measures, such as harnesses for working at heights and fall protection systems, is crucial for contractors who frequently work on ladders or scaffolding. Regular training on safety protocols and equipment usage further enhances workplace safety, ensuring that all team members are well-prepared to handle potential hazards in their environment.

How Advanced Equipment Enhances Efficiency and Quality

Smart Tools for Smart Lighting Systems

With the rise of smart lighting technologies, lighting contractors must adapt by integrating smart tools into their workflow. Devices capable of interfacing with digital lighting controls, such as wireless testers and programmable controllers, streamline installation and calibration processes.

For example, Bluetooth-enabled testers allow contractors to diagnose and adjust lighting systems remotely, reducing the need for repeated site visits. This not only saves time but also improves client satisfaction by delivering faster and more precise service. Furthermore, these smart tools often come equipped with data logging capabilities, enabling contractors to track system performance over time. This information can be invaluable for identifying patterns, forecasting maintenance needs, and providing clients with detailed reports that illustrate the efficiency and effectiveness of their lighting systems.

Ergonomics and Portability

Ergonomically designed tools reduce fatigue and enhance precision, which is especially important during prolonged installations or when working in confined spaces. Lightweight and compact equipment improves maneuverability, enabling contractors to access difficult areas without compromising safety or quality.

Portability also means that contractors can carry a comprehensive range of tools without excessive burden, ensuring they are prepared for any unexpected challenges on site. The integration of modular tool systems further enhances this aspect, allowing contractors to customize their toolkits based on specific job requirements. This flexibility not only maximizes efficiency but also minimizes the risk of leaving essential tools behind, which can lead to delays and increased costs. Additionally, advancements in battery technology have led to longer-lasting, rechargeable power sources that keep tools running smoothly throughout the day, making it easier for contractors to focus on delivering high-quality installations without interruption.

Maintaining and Upgrading Equipment for Continued Success

Regular Maintenance Practices

Proper maintenance of electrician equipment extends its lifespan and ensures consistent performance. This includes routine cleaning, calibration of testing devices, and timely replacement of worn-out parts.

Contractors should establish a maintenance schedule and keep detailed records to track the condition of their tools. This proactive approach prevents unexpected failures and supports compliance with safety regulations.

Staying Current with Technological Advances

The lighting industry is evolving rapidly, with innovations in LED technology, automation, and energy management. Lighting contractors must stay informed about new tools and equipment that support these trends.

Attending trade shows, participating in professional training, and subscribing to industry publications are effective ways to keep abreast of technological developments. Upgrading equipment periodically ensures that contractors can meet the demands of modern lighting projects and maintain their competitive advantage.
